
Many people wonder whether they can repurpose coffee grounds by placing them in a wax warmer to infuse their space with a coffee aroma. While coffee grounds themselves do not melt or release fragrance like wax melts, they can be creatively combined with other materials, such as essential oils or carrier wax, to achieve a coffee-scented effect. However, placing dry coffee grounds directly into a wax warmer is not recommended, as they may burn or produce smoke, potentially damaging the warmer or creating an unpleasant odor. Instead, consider alternative methods like making DIY coffee-scented wax melts or using coffee grounds in other household applications to enjoy their aroma safely.

Safety Concerns: Are coffee grounds safe to use in wax warmers without causing damage?
Coffee grounds, when placed in a wax warmer, introduce a combustible organic material into a device designed for wax. Unlike wax, which melts and disperses heat evenly, coffee grounds retain moisture and can clump, creating hot spots that may exceed the warmer’s intended temperature range. This raises the risk of overheating, potentially damaging the warmer’s heating element or causing the plastic components to warp or melt. While the grounds themselves are not flammable at typical wax warmer temperatures (around 130°F to 180°F), their presence can disrupt the device’s thermal balance, leading to safety hazards.
From a practical standpoint, using coffee grounds in a wax warmer requires careful consideration of quantity and preparation. If attempting this, limit the grounds to a thin, even layer (no more than 1 tablespoon) and ensure they are completely dry to minimize moisture-related risks. However, even with these precautions, the grounds may not disperse fragrance effectively, as they lack the oil-binding properties of wax. Instead, they may burn or char, releasing an acrid odor rather than the desired coffee aroma. This trial-and-error approach is not recommended for long-term use due to the potential for residue buildup, which could clog the warmer or void its warranty.
A comparative analysis highlights the difference between wax warmers and other fragrance devices. Unlike diffusers or stovetop simmer pots, wax warmers are not designed to handle particulate matter. Simmer pots, for instance, use water as a medium, allowing coffee grounds to steep safely without direct contact with a heating element. Wax warmers, however, rely on direct heat, making them incompatible with materials that do not melt uniformly. This fundamental design difference underscores why coffee grounds pose a safety risk in wax warmers but not in other fragrance devices.
Persuasively, the safest alternative for achieving a coffee-scented ambiance is to use purpose-designed products. Coffee-scented wax melts or essential oils offer a controlled fragrance release without compromising the warmer’s integrity. For those determined to experiment, consider a DIY approach using a double-boiler method: place the grounds in a heat-safe container, set it atop a wax warmer, and allow the indirect heat to release the aroma. This method eliminates direct contact with the heating element, reducing the risk of damage. Ultimately, while creativity in fragrance is commendable, prioritizing safety ensures both the device’s longevity and the user’s peace of mind.

Cleaning Tips: How to clean wax warmers after using coffee grounds without residue
Using coffee grounds in a wax warmer can infuse your space with a rich, aromatic scent, but it leaves behind a residue that requires careful cleaning. Unlike traditional wax melts, coffee grounds introduce organic matter that can cling to surfaces, making cleanup more involved. To restore your wax warmer to a pristine state, start by allowing the device to cool completely. Attempting to clean a warm or hot wax warmer not only risks burns but can also spread the residue further. Once cooled, the grounds will have hardened, making them easier to remove without creating a mess.
Begin the cleaning process by scraping out the bulk of the coffee grounds using a non-abrasive tool, such as a silicone spatula or a plastic spoon. Avoid metal utensils, as they can scratch the surface of the warmer. For warmers with removable dishes, take the dish to a sink and rinse it under warm water to dislodge any loose grounds. If the dish is not removable, use a damp cloth to wipe away as much residue as possible. This initial step significantly reduces the amount of grounds left to deal with, streamlining the deeper cleaning process.
Next, address the stubborn residue by creating a cleaning solution of equal parts warm water and white vinegar. Vinegar’s acidity helps break down the oils and particles left by the coffee grounds. Dip a soft cloth or sponge into the solution and gently scrub the affected areas. For hard-to-reach spots, a cotton swab dipped in the solution can be effective. Rinse the cloth or sponge frequently to avoid redistributing the residue. Follow this step by wiping the warmer with a clean, damp cloth to remove any vinegar residue, as its scent can linger and interfere with future use.
For particularly stubborn residue, consider using a small amount of mild dish soap in warm water. Dish soap’s degreasing properties can tackle any remaining oils from the coffee grounds. Apply the soapy water with a soft cloth, scrubbing gently, and then rinse thoroughly with a damp cloth to ensure no soap remains. Drying the warmer completely with a lint-free towel prevents water spots and ensures it’s ready for its next use. This method is especially useful for wax warmers with intricate designs or crevices where residue tends to accumulate.
Finally, inspect the wax warmer for any remaining residue or odors. If a faint coffee scent persists, place a cotton ball soaked in vanilla extract or a few drops of essential oil in the warmer while it’s off to neutralize the smell. Regular maintenance, such as cleaning the warmer after each use and avoiding overfilling with coffee grounds, can prevent buildup and make future cleaning sessions quicker and easier. With these steps, your wax warmer will remain residue-free and ready to enhance your space with whatever scent you choose next.

Alternative Uses: Can coffee grounds be repurposed in other home fragrance methods?
Coffee grounds, often discarded after brewing, hold untapped potential for enhancing home fragrance beyond the wax warmer. Their natural aroma and absorbent properties make them versatile for various scent-related applications. For instance, placing a small bowl of dried coffee grounds in the refrigerator can neutralize odors, acting as a chemical-free alternative to baking soda. The grounds absorb unwanted smells while releasing a subtle, earthy fragrance that complements rather than overwhelms.
Instructively, creating coffee ground sachets offers a DIY solution for freshening drawers, closets, or even cars. Simply fill a breathable fabric pouch with 1/4 to 1/2 cup of dried grounds, tie it securely, and place it in the desired area. For added complexity, mix the grounds with a few drops of essential oils like lavender or citrus to create a customized scent profile. These sachets last 2–3 weeks before needing replenishment, making them a sustainable and cost-effective option.
Comparatively, while wax warmers rely on heat to diffuse fragrance, coffee grounds can be used in simmer pots for a stovetop alternative. Combine 1 cup of water, 1/2 cup of coffee grounds, and spices like cinnamon or cloves in a small saucepan. Simmer on low heat to release a warm, inviting aroma throughout the home. This method is particularly effective during colder months, offering a cozy ambiance without the need for artificial scents or open flames.
Persuasively, coffee grounds’ deodorizing capabilities extend to pet areas, where odors can be stubborn. Sprinkle a thin layer of dried grounds on carpets or pet beds, let them sit for 15–20 minutes, then vacuum them up. This not only eliminates smells but also leaves behind a mild, natural fragrance. For best results, use freshly dried grounds, as moisture can lead to mold if left unattended.
Descriptively, incorporating coffee grounds into homemade candles adds both fragrance and texture. Mix 1–2 tablespoons of finely ground coffee into melted soy or beeswax before pouring it into a container. The grounds create a speckled appearance while infusing the candle with a rich, roasted aroma. When lit, the scent is subtly released, providing a unique sensory experience that combines visual appeal with olfactory delight.
In conclusion, coffee grounds offer a multifaceted approach to home fragrance, transcending their traditional role in brewing. From odor neutralization to aromatic enhancements, their adaptability makes them a valuable resource for those seeking natural, eco-friendly alternatives. By experimenting with these methods, individuals can repurpose coffee grounds creatively, turning waste into a fragrant asset.
